    Mushkin 2GB XP4000 Redline CE-5 – Test Results

    Hey guys, I recently got a set of the “new” Redline XP4000 (part #991493) to test. This stuff uses Infineon CE-5 chips which seem to clock better than CE-6 and as far as I can see have no 3d stability issues. The RAM came from Mushkin and is a retail set, not hand picked; I’ve been told the recent batch of CE-5 is clocking quite well. I am going to share my results, suggested timings/tweeks, and impressions of the mem. First off a pic of the RAM:




    Test bed:
    DFI LP NF4 Ultra D (BIOS 0704-2BTA)
    FX-57
    BFG GeForce 7800GTX @ 540/1385
    OCZ PowerStream 520W
    Windows Server 2003
    Cooling - Custom H20


    I started at DDR510 and 2.65v and once I got the drive strength and secondaries nailed down moving up from there was easy. Unlike XP4000 UCCC chips, CE-5 scales somewhat with voltage. 2.67v got DDR560, 2.77v got DDR566.

    Secondary timings and drive strength are important w/ this RAM, the wrong drive strength or 1 secondary off and you cant boot. See the settings below or my tweeker screenie to see what settings worked for me. *Note these settings are the TIGHTEST possible that still maintain stability at the speeds I am running the RAM. Some can be relaxed a bit, YRMV. Also what settings work for me may differ slightly for you because of system differences.*

    BIOS Settings:
    Command Per Clock Enable
    TCL-3.0
    TRCD-03
    TRAS-06
    TRP-2
    TRC-7
    tRFC-13
    TRRD-02
    tWR-02
    tWTR-01
    TRWT-03
    tREF-4708
    tWCL-01
    DRAM Bank Interleave-enabled
    DQS Skew Control - auto
    DQS Skew Value- 0
    DRAM Drive Strength - Level 7
    DRAM Data Drive Strength - Level 3
    Max Async Latency- 8ns
    DRAM Response Time - Normal
    Read preamble Time- 5ns
    Idle Cycle Limit- 00clks
    Dyanamic Counter - Enable
    r/w Queue bypass: 16X
    Bypass Max - 07X
    32 Byte Granularity - Auto
    Vdimm-2.6v + 0.03v in BIOS


    OCing summary

    3-3-2
    2.69v – 280Mhz
    2.80v – 283Mhz
    2.88v – 287Mhz

    2.5-3-2
    2.95v - 260Mhz


    *Notes*
    • Voltages are actual as measured by DMM
    • Results are 32M and 3DMark 05 stable
    • See next post for screenshots
